šŸ¢ ABOUT THE COMPANY

ADP was founded in 1944 and is one of the world's leading providers of human capital management solutions. Our mission is to help businesses thrive by providing innovative, scalable, and secure HR solutions. With over 60,000 employees globally, ADP operates in more than 140 countries, supporting more than 850,000 clients. We pride ourselves on our strong values: inclusivity, respect, integrity, and teamwork.
